Default New build getting tuned on saturday

Hey guys, I just figured I'd post that my build is finally done. I have forged pauter rods, stock compression wiseco pistons, ARP studs, a 6 puck sprung ACT clutch, and did a BSD on the motor. My turbo setup is a GT3076 with a tial 38mm external wastegate with a pg version 3 manifold, and full 3" CP-E inlet and intake. For boost control I am using the grimmspeed EBCS and will be getting a tune at Akuma motorsports on saturday with the COBB accessport. I'll post the dyno sheets in the dyno section as soon as I can when I get back! Hopefully I can post some decent numbers without meth. Wish me luck!

Ok well I'll post the pic of the sheet up tommorrow. It was on a mustang dyno with the ATP fail flange. At 17 PSI I got 289 HP and 279 TQ. I will be doing some over the internet tuning to get my boost up. On the dyno doing a one gear pull no matter what gear it will only hit 17 PSI however when running through multiple gears on the street or the dyno it will hit 19.5 and hold there. Kinda tough to see what the numbers actually are at the 19.5 but I'm going to work with John to try to get it perfect. John was very picky about the way he tuned it and as you will see when I post it up the power curves are awsome. Definitely a good guy to go to for a tune. (I will however be most likely going to a stand back within the next 6 months or so If I cannot get the numbers I want out of the AP.

Originally Posted by mason View Post
what is flat foot shifting? (with the AP?)
Keeping your foot pressed against the gas pedal (all the way to the floor) while shifting. I.e. not letting off the gas at all.
